Learning outcomes

Understand the fundamental principles of human physiology, with particular reference to the cardiovascular, respiratory, nervous, and muscular systems.
Analyze the physiological basis of tissue trophism and perfusion, with particular attention to the function of the foot and lower limbs.
Apply physiological concepts to the interpretation of pathological conditions involving the lower limb.

Prerequisites

Basic knowledge of general biology, particularly cell structure and function. Basic knowledge of human anatomy and physiology, particularly the major systems (muscular, skeletal, cardiovascular, nervous).

Module: PODOLOGICAL SCIENCES

Nail: anatomy and physiology. The three most common laminar forms.
Onychopathies: etiopathogenesis, clinical manifestation, treatment, and differential diagnosis.
Onychocryptosis: classification and conservative and surgical treatments.
Cutaneous and nail mycoses: notes on mycology.
Onychomycoses: etiopathogenesis and main responsible fungi; how to perform the search for positivity (direct microscopy, culture in Dermatest and on Agar plate).
Antifungal resistance.
Tinea pedis and its treatment.
Occupational risks: knowing and preventing them.
Thermography as a new investigative tool in podiatric diseases.
